Kinsale, VA demographics:
population, income, and more
Kinsale population
How many people live in Kinsale
Kinsale is home to 1,367 residents, according to the most recent Census data. Gender-wise, 43.4% of Kinsale locals are male, and 56.6% are female.
Age demographics
Adults between 25 and 44 make up 21.4% of the population, while another 32.5% fall into the 45 to 64 bracket. Finally, around 35.5% are 65 or older.
Racial makeup
In Kinsale, 93.8% of the population are US-born citizens, while 6.2% have gained naturalized citizenship. There’s also a share of 3.2% that includes residents with two or more races.
Households in Kinsale
A peek inside Kinsale households
Kinsale has 643 households, with an average of 2 members in each. Of these, 53.6% are families, while the remaining 46.4% are made up of individuals living alone or with non-relatives, such as roommates.
Households stats
Housing in Kinsale
The housing landscape of Kinsale
Kinsale's housing consists of 814 units, with 80.2% being detached single-family homes ideal for those wanting space. Then there are the multifamily buildings in the area, and for those seeking flexibility, non-traditional options like mobile homes account for 14.5% of the housing landscape.
The age of buildings in Kinsale
In Kinsale, the median construction year is 1981. About 7.9% of homes were built before the 1940s, with another 3.9% going up by 1949. Most development happened in the second half of the 20th century.
Kinsale occupancy rates
Out of the 643 occupied housing units in Kinsale, 75.7% are owner-occupied, while 24.3% are lived in by tenants. Meanwhile, 21% of all homes on the local market sit vacant.

Education in Kinsale
Kinsale education at a glance
About 47% of the population in Kinsale went to high school, while 12.7% pursued college studies. Another 5.4% earned an associate degree and 23.2% hold a bachelor’s. Meanwhile, 5.6% went even further, earning a master’s or doctorate.
Income in Kinsale
How much people earn in Kinsale
The average annual household income in Kinsale was $60,940 in 2024, the most recent annual data available, according to the U.S. Census Bureau. This marked a +2% change from the previous year.
Kinsale income by age
Overall, 78.9% of the locals in this community live above the poverty line.
Employment in Kinsale
Workforce and job types in Kinsale
71.7% of the working population are employed in professional or administrative positions, while 28.3% are in hands-on or service-based jobs. Also, 11.1% run their own businesses, 43.5% are employed by private companies, and 18.8% work in the public sector.
Workforce demographics
Transportation in Kinsale
How people get around in Kinsale
Commuting methods vary: 94.8% of residents travel by personal vehicle and 5.2% prefer to walk, while the remaining share relies on public transit or on two wheelers to get from A to B.

What is the age distribution of the population in Kinsale?
- Under 15: 10.6% (145 residents)
- Ages 15-24: 0% ( residents)
- Ages 25-44: 21.4% (293 residents)
- Ages 45-64: 32.5% (444 residents)
- Over 65: 35.5% (485 residents)
What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Kinsale?
- White: 47.7% (652 residents)
- Black or African American: 49.2% (672 residents)
- American Indian and Alaska Native: 0% ( residents)
- Asian: 0% ( residents)
- Native Hawaiian and Other Pacific Islander: 0% ( residents)
- Two or More Races: 3.2% (43 residents)
- Other: 0% ( residents)
